自监督生成模型的泛化能力

上传人:永*** 文档编号:375855252 上传时间:2024-01-07 格式:PPTX 页数:31 大小:272.17KB
返回 下载 相关 举报
自监督生成模型的泛化能力_第1页
第1页 / 共31页
自监督生成模型的泛化能力_第2页
第2页 / 共31页
自监督生成模型的泛化能力_第3页
第3页 / 共31页
自监督生成模型的泛化能力_第4页
第4页 / 共31页
自监督生成模型的泛化能力_第5页
第5页 / 共31页
点击查看更多>>
资源描述

《自监督生成模型的泛化能力》由会员分享,可在线阅读,更多相关《自监督生成模型的泛化能力(31页珍藏版)》请在金锄头文库上搜索。

1、数智创新数智创新数智创新数智创新 变革未来变革未来变革未来变革未来自监督生成模型的泛化能力1.引言:自监督生成模型概述1.泛化能力:定义与重要性1.模型结构:影响泛化能力的因素1.数据集:规模与多样性的影响1.训练技巧:提高泛化能力的方法1.评估方法:衡量泛化能力的标准1.对比实验:不同模型的泛化能力比较1.结论:自监督生成模型的泛化能力总结目录目录Index 引言:自监督生成模型概述自自监监督生成模型的泛化能力督生成模型的泛化能力 引言:自监督生成模型概述1.自监督生成模型是一种利用无标签数据进行训练的模型,能够学习到数据集的内在规律和结构,从而生成新的数据样本。2.自监督生成模型在深度学习

2、领域的应用越来越广泛,可以用于图像生成、语音识别、自然语言处理等多个任务。3.自监督生成模型的泛化能力是其重要的性能指标之一,能够反映模型在未知数据上的表现能力。自监督生成模型的基本原理1.自监督生成模型通过最大化生成数据与原始数据之间的相似度来训练模型参数,使得生成的样本与原始样本尽可能接近。2.自监督生成模型通常采用神经网络结构,通过反向传播算法来更新模型参数。3.自监督生成模型可以与其他的深度学习模型进行结合,提高模型的性能表现。自监督生成模型的定义和重要性 引言:自监督生成模型概述自监督生成模型的泛化能力研究现状1.目前自监督生成模型的泛化能力研究主要集中在图像生成领域,取得了一定的研

3、究成果。2.研究表明,自监督生成模型的泛化能力与模型的结构、训练数据集的大小和质量等因素相关。3.通过改进模型结构、增加训练数据集和提高数据质量等方法,可以进一步提高自监督生成模型的泛化能力。自监督生成模型的应用场景1.自监督生成模型可以用于图像生成,可以生成高质量、多样化的图像样本。2.在语音识别领域,自监督生成模型可以用于生成语音样本,提高语音识别的性能。3.在自然语言处理领域,自监督生成模型可以用于文本生成、文本转换等任务。引言:自监督生成模型概述1.随着深度学习技术的不断发展,自监督生成模型将会得到更广泛的应用。2.未来研究将会更加注重自监督生成模型的泛化能力和鲁棒性,提高模型在未知数

4、据上的表现能力。3.自监督生成模型将会与其他的机器学习技术进行结合,形成更加完善的人工智能系统。自监督生成模型的未来发展趋势Index 泛化能力:定义与重要性自自监监督生成模型的泛化能力督生成模型的泛化能力 泛化能力:定义与重要性泛化能力的定义1.泛化能力是指模型在新数据上的表现能力,即对未见过的数据进行预测或分类的能力。2.泛化能力是机器学习模型的重要性能指标之一,反映了模型的实用性和可靠性。3.好的泛化能力意味着模型能够从训练数据中学习到有用的信息,并将其应用于新数据中,取得较好的表现。泛化能力:定义与重要性泛化能力的重要性1.泛化能力决定了机器学习模型在实际应用中的价值,因为实际应用中遇

5、到的数据往往与训练数据不同。2.泛化能力不足会导致模型在训练数据上表现良好,但在新数据上表现较差,即出现过拟合现象。3.提高泛化能力是机器学习研究的重要目标之一,有助于提高模型的适用范围和实用性。为了更好地理解和评估模型的泛化能力,研究者们提出了各种泛化能力的度量和评估方法。其中,最常见的是通过交叉验证来评估模型的泛化能力。交叉验证将数据集划分为训练集和验证集,使用训练集来训练模型,然后在验证集上评估模型的表现。通过多次重复验证,可以得到模型在不同数据集上的平均表现,从而评估模型的泛化能力。在生成模型中,泛化能力也至关重要。生成模型需要学习数据分布并生成新的数据样本,因此泛化能力决定了生成模型

6、生成新数据的质量和多样性。为了提高生成模型的泛化能力,研究者们采用了各种技术,如增加数据集的多样性、引入噪声、使用正则化等。总之,泛化能力是机器学习模型的重要性能指标之一,对于生成模型尤为重要。提高泛化能力有助于提高模型的实用性和可靠性,是机器学习研究的重要目标之一。Index 模型结构:影响泛化能力的因素自自监监督生成模型的泛化能力督生成模型的泛化能力 模型结构:影响泛化能力的因素1.模型复杂度越高,表示模型具有更强的表达能力,能够学习更复杂的数据模式,从而提高泛化能力。2.然而,过高的模型复杂度也可能导致过拟合现象,降低泛化能力。3.因此,选择适当的模型复杂度是提高泛化能力的重要因素。数据

7、质量1.数据质量对模型的泛化能力具有重要影响,高质量的数据可以提高模型的泛化能力。2.数据噪声和异常值可能导致模型学习到错误的数据模式,降低泛化能力。3.数据预处理和数据清洗技术可以提高数据质量,从而提高模型的泛化能力。模型复杂度 模型结构:影响泛化能力的因素训练策略1.合适的训练策略可以提高模型的泛化能力,例如采用批次归一化、早停等技术。2.不同的优化算法对模型的泛化能力也有影响,选择适当的优化算法可以提高泛化能力。3.在训练过程中,采用适当的正则化技术可以防止过拟合,提高泛化能力。模型架构1.不同的模型架构对泛化能力的影响不同,选择适当的模型架构可以提高泛化能力。2.采用深度神经网络可以提

8、高模型的表达能力,进而提高泛化能力。3.引入卷积层、池化层等技术可以提高模型的空间抽象能力,提高泛化能力。模型结构:影响泛化能力的因素1.当模型应用于不同领域时,其泛化能力可能会受到影响。2.提高模型在不同领域间的适应性可以提高其泛化能力。3.采用领域自适应技术,例如迁移学习、域适应等,可以提高模型的泛化能力。评估与调试1.对模型进行评估和调试是提高泛化能力的重要环节。2.采用适当的评估指标可以对模型的泛化能力进行量化评估。3.通过调试模型的超参数和架构,可以进一步提高模型的泛化能力。领域适应性Index 数据集:规模与多样性的影响自自监监督生成模型的泛化能力督生成模型的泛化能力 数据集:规模

9、与多样性的影响数据集规模对泛化能力的影响1.数据集规模越大,模型能够学习到的特征越丰富,有助于提高泛化能力。2.大规模数据集可以提供更多的样本,有助于模型减少对特定数据的过度拟合,从而提高泛化能力。3.在训练过程中,适当的数据增强可以进一步增加数据集的规模,有助于提高模型的泛化能力。数据集多样性对泛化能力的影响1.数据集多样性越高,模型能够学习到的特征越广泛,有助于提高泛化能力。2.多样性不足的数据集可能导致模型在特定数据上表现良好,但在其他数据上表现较差。3.通过增加数据集的多样性,可以减少模型对特定数据的偏见,提高模型的公正性和泛化能力。数据集:规模与多样性的影响数据预处理对泛化能力的影响

10、1.合适的数据预处理可以提高数据的质量,有助于模型学习到更好的特征,提高泛化能力。2.数据预处理的方法应该根据具体数据集和任务来选择,不同的预处理方法可能对泛化能力产生不同的影响。模型复杂度对泛化能力的影响1.模型复杂度过高可能导致过拟合,复杂度过低可能导致欠拟合,都会影响泛化能力。2.选择合适的模型复杂度可以平衡拟合程度和泛化能力,提高模型的性能。数据集:规模与多样性的影响训练技巧对泛化能力的影响1.使用适当的训练技巧,如早停、正则化等,可以减少过拟合,提高泛化能力。2.不同的训练技巧可能对不同的模型和任务有不同的效果,需要根据实际情况选择合适的训练技巧。评估方法对泛化能力的影响1.选择合适

11、的评估方法可以准确评估模型的泛化能力,为后续改进提供准确的指导。2.不同的评估方法可能对同一模型有不同的评估结果,需要根据实际任务和需求选择合适的评估方法。Index 训练技巧:提高泛化能力的方法自自监监督生成模型的泛化能力督生成模型的泛化能力 训练技巧:提高泛化能力的方法数据增强1.通过数据增强,可以在原始数据基础上生成新的训练样本,增加模型的泛化能力。2.数据增强可以通过随机变换、裁剪、旋转等操作实现。3.数据增强需要注意保持数据的标签信息不变。模型结构1.采用深度卷积神经网络可以提高模型的泛化能力。2.引入残差结构可以减少模型训练时的梯度消失问题,提高模型泛化能力。3.采用注意力机制可以

12、使得模型更好地关注到重要的特征,提高模型泛化能力。训练技巧:提高泛化能力的方法正则化1.正则化是一种有效的提高模型泛化能力的方法。2.L1正则化可以使得模型参数更加稀疏,L2正则化可以使得模型参数更加平滑。3.采用Dropout技术可以随机丢弃一部分神经元,减少过拟合现象,提高泛化能力。学习率调整1.合适的学习率可以使得模型在训练过程中更好地收敛,提高泛化能力。2.采用学习率衰减技术可以使得模型在训练后期更好地收敛,提高泛化能力。3.采用自适应优化算法可以根据不同参数的重要性自动调整学习率,提高泛化能力。训练技巧:提高泛化能力的方法批量归一化1.批量归一化可以使得模型更好地适应不同的数据分布,

13、提高泛化能力。2.批量归一化可以减少模型训练时的内部协变量偏移问题,提高模型的稳定性。3.批量归一化可以加速模型的训练收敛速度,提高训练效率。模型集成1.模型集成可以将多个模型的预测结果进行融合,提高模型的泛化能力。2.采用简单的平均法或者加权平均法可以对多个模型进行集成。3.模型集成可以有效地减少单个模型的过拟合现象,提高模型的鲁棒性。Index 评估方法:衡量泛化能力的标准自自监监督生成模型的泛化能力督生成模型的泛化能力 评估方法:衡量泛化能力的标准模型在训练集和测试集上的性能比较1.比较模型在训练集和测试集上的性能是评估泛化能力的基本方法。2.通过观察模型在训练集和测试集上的准确率、损失

14、函数等指标的变化,可以初步判断模型的泛化能力。3.如果模型在训练集上的性能很好,但在测试集上的性能较差,说明模型出现了过拟合现象,泛化能力较差。基于数据分割的评估方法1.将数据集分成训练集、验证集和测试集,使用验证集来选择模型,使用测试集来评估模型的泛化能力。2.常见的数据分割方法有随机分割、交叉验证等。3.通过比较不同分割方法下模型的泛化能力,可以更全面地评估模型的性能。评估方法:衡量泛化能力的标准基于模型复杂度的评估方法1.模型复杂度越高,拟合训练数据的能力越强,但也容易导致过拟合现象。2.通过比较不同复杂度下模型的泛化能力,可以选择泛化能力最好的模型。3.常见的模型复杂度评估方法有VC维

15、、Rademacher复杂度等。基于正则化的评估方法1.正则化是一种控制模型复杂度、防止过拟合的方法。2.通过比较不同正则化强度下模型的泛化能力,可以选择最合适的正则化强度。3.常见的正则化方法有L1正则化、L2正则化等。评估方法:衡量泛化能力的标准基于集成学习的评估方法1.集成学习可以提高模型的泛化能力和稳定性。2.通过比较不同集成学习方法下模型的泛化能力,可以选择最合适的集成学习方法。3.常见的集成学习方法有Bagging、Boosting等。基于可视化技术的评估方法1.可视化技术可以直观地展示模型的泛化能力。2.通过比较不同可视化方法下模型的表现,可以更全面地评估模型的泛化能力。3.常见

16、的可视化方法有t-SNE、PCA等。Index 对比实验:不同模型的泛化能力比较自自监监督生成模型的泛化能力督生成模型的泛化能力 对比实验:不同模型的泛化能力比较模型A的泛化能力1.模型A在训练集上的表现优秀,但在测试集上的表现较差,说明其泛化能力不强。2.通过对比其他模型,发现模型A的过拟合现象较为严重,导致泛化能力不足。3.针对模型A的泛化能力问题,可以采取增加数据集、添加正则化项等方法进行改进。模型B的泛化能力1.模型B在训练集和测试集上的表现都较为稳定,说明其泛化能力较强。2.通过对比其他模型,发现模型B的结构设计较为合理,有效避免了过拟合现象的出现。3.针对模型B的泛化能力优势,可以进一步探索其应用场景,提高模型的应用价值。对比实验:不同模型的泛化能力比较模型C的泛化能力1.模型C在训练集上的表现较好,但在测试集上的表现波动较大,说明其泛化能力有一定的不稳定性。2.通过对比其他模型,发现模型C的参数调整对其泛化能力影响较大,需要进一步优化参数调整策略。3.针对模型C的泛化能力问题,可以研究其不稳定的原因,并采取相应的改进措施提高其泛化能力。Index 结论:自监督生成模型的泛

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 办公文档 > 解决方案

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号